Riboflavin Kinase is a vitamin that is needed for growth and overall good health. It helps the body break down carbohydrates, proteins and fats to produce energy, and it allows oxygen to be used by the body. In enzymology, Riboflavin Kinase is an enzyme that works as catalysis for ATP. Riboflavin is known as Vitamin B2 and is converted into flavin mononucleotide (FMN) and flavin adenine dinucleotide (FAD) by riboflavin kinase and FMN adenylyltransferase, respectively.
